The term injury prevention is defined as the effort that should be done aiming to prevent further injuries as well as to reduce the severity of an injury brought about by external mechanisms such as accidents before it will occur.
Here are examples of ways to prevent injury:
1. Always wear protective gears, especially when driving or biking. Protective gears include helmets, and protective pads.
2. Before doing an activity or exercise, always make sure to do some warm up first and then cool down after.
3. When you are playing e.g. sports, always know the rules and watch out for others as well. Never or avoid playing if you are currently having an injury.
